LMOD.7 – .5
LCD Output Segment and Pin Configuration Bits
0
0
0
Segments 40–43, 44–47, 48–51 and 52–55

NOTE: Segment pins that also can used for normal I/O should be configured to output mode
when the SEG function is used.
LMOD.4 – .3
LCD Clock (LCDCK) Frequency Selection Bits

NOTE: LCDCK is supplied only when the watch timer operates. To use the LCD controller,
bit 2 in the watch mode register WMOD should be set to 1.
LMOD.2
LCD Duty and Selection Bits
0
1/8 duty (COM0–COM7 select)
1
1/16 duty (COM0–COM15 select)
NOTE: When 1/16 duty is selected, ports 4 and 5 should be configured as output mode;
when 1/8 duty is selected, ports 4 and 5 can be used as normal I/O ports.
